Description

MinIO Operator STS is a native IAM Authentication for Kubernetes. Prior to version 7.1.0, if no audiences are provided for the `spec.audiences` field, the default will be of the Kubernetes apiserver. Without scoping, it can be replayed to other internal systems, which may unintentionally trust it. This issue has been patched in version 7.1.0.
